Ukrainian families in North Bay marking war anniversary

Local Ukrainians are marking a grim anniversary on Saturday.  

Feb. 24 is the second anniversary of the Russian invasion of Ukraine, which officials say has displaced millions of people and killed hundreds of thousands, with no end in sight. 

More than two dozen Ukrainian families have since settled in North Bay. 

They’ll be gathering near the food court at Northgate Shopping Centre at noon on Saturday to sing and talk about the impact of the war.  

They’re also calling for continued support to repel the Russians from their homeland.
